The Ecomuseum of Somiedo is situated in the Asturian localities of Caunedo and Veigas, both within the council of Somiedo. This location in the heart of Asturias offers visitors the opportunity to explore the beautiful natural surroundings in addition to the museum itself. The museum's location also provides a context for the exhibits, as they reflect the traditions and culture of the local area.

Focus on Traditional Occupations and Vegetal Cover Constructions

The Ecomuseum of Somiedo has a specific focus on highlighting the traditional occupations of the area, as well as the unique vegetal cover constructions. This focus allows visitors to gain a deeper understanding of the historical and cultural context of the region. The exhibits provide a glimpse into the past, showcasing the traditional ways of life and the unique architectural styles of the area.
